Lung Fitness for Flu Season.
Everyone dreads getting sick in the wintertime, but some people find themselves unusually vulnerable to respiratory infections... most particularly those who have asthma or a history of bronchitis. Yes, we all know about flu shots and washing hands and avoiding crowds, but did you realize there's lots more you can do to fortify yourself -- and your respiratory system in particular -- even before the sick season kicks in? Andrew L. Rubman, ND, Daily Health News contributing medical editor, had advice on getting fit to fight the flu.
